Flute Sight-Reading 1 aims to establish good practice and provide an early introduction to the essential skill of sight-reading.
Sight-reading in some form should become a regular part of a student's routine each time they get out the flute, and this book aims to establish the habit early in a student's learning process.
There are 8 sections, which in a logical sequence gradually introduce new notes, rhythms, articulations, dynamics and Italian terms - much as you would find in a beginner's flute method.
The emphasis is on providing idiomatic tunes and structures rather than sterile sight-reading exercises.
Each section contains several solo examples, beginning with only three notes, and concludes with duets and accompanied pieces, allowing the student to gain experience of sight-reading within the context of ensemble playing.
